Louisiana HB 917 (2024) — EARLY CHILDHOOD: Provides that Act No. 84 of the 2023 Regular Session of the Legislature shall be known and may be cited as "Armani's Law"

Timeline

The legislative action history — every referral, reading, and vote.

  • 2024-05-28 Effective date: 08/01/2024.
  • 2024-05-28 Signed by the Governor. Becomes Act No. 391. became-law, executive-signature
  • 2024-05-22 Sent to the Governor for executive approval. executive-receipt
  • 2024-05-20 Signed by the President of the Senate.
  • 2024-05-20 Enrolled and signed by the Speaker of the House. enrolled
  • 2024-05-20 Received from the Senate without amendments. receipt
  • 2024-05-15 Rules suspended. Read by title, passed by a vote of 36 yeas and 0 nays, and ordered returned to the House. Motion to reconsider tabled. passage
  • 2024-05-14 Reported without Legislative Bureau amendments. Read by title and passed to third reading and final passage. reading-3
  • 2024-05-13 Read by title and referred to the Legislative Bureau.
  • 2024-05-08 Reported favorably. committee-passage-favorable
  • 2024-04-29 Read second time by title and referred to the Committee on Education. reading-2, referral-committee
  • 2024-04-24 Received in the Senate. Read first time by title and placed on the Calendar for a second reading. reading-1
  • 2024-04-23 Read third time by title, roll called on final passage, yeas 101, nays 0. Finally passed, title adopted, ordered to the Senate. passage
  • 2024-04-18 Scheduled for floor debate on 04/23/2024.
  • 2024-04-17 Read by title, amended, ordered engrossed, passed to 3rd reading. reading-3
  • 2024-04-16 Reported with amendments (13-0). committee-passage-favorable
  • 2024-04-03 Read by title, under the rules, referred to the Committee on Education. referral-committee
  • 2024-04-02 Read by title. Lies over under the rules.
